How to get from Mill Road to Ucc Connolly Building by bus and train?

From Mill Road to Ucc Connolly Building by bus and train

To get from Mill Road to Ucc Connolly Building in Ireland, you’ll need to take one bus line and 2 train lines: take the 301 bus from Mill Road station to Limerick Colbert Station station. Next, you’ll have to switch to the RAIL train and finally take the INTERCITY train from Limerick Junction station to Cork (Kent) station. The total trip duration for this route is approximately 2 hr 46 min. The bus and train schedule from Mill Road may change.
